"The incredible ability of generative AI to produce texts and images that are both complex and plausible has very early on worried the creative professions," recall Jean Ponce, Professor of Computer Science at the École Normale Supérieure – PSL, and Isabelle Ryl, Professor of Computer Science, on secondment at PSL University, in a point of view published in Le Monde.

But, "as AI practitioners and researchers," the two authors believe that "the artistic field can be, just like science and industry, an exciting source of new problems and scientific challenges to be addressed, as well as an opportunity to create a new playground where artists and AI researchers can together find new expressions for their creativity."
